H.R. 7339 (115th)

Medicare for America Act of 2018

Summary

Medicare for America Act of 2018 This bill establishes a national health insurance program to be administered by the Department of Health and Human Services. Among other requirements, the program must (1) cover all U.S. residents; (2) cover specified items and services, including hospital services, prescription drugs, and dental services; and (3) be fully implemented in 2022.
